Publishing online means media outlets can edit or even delete articles that ruffle feathers, but screenshots and internet archives mean there’s a trail of evidence. The Sarasota Herald-Tribune attempted to memory hole an op-ed published on Sunday that defended the Proud Boys as simply “caring fathers,” without disclosing that the author was married to a member of the group.

The original op-ed was titled “Attacking Proud Boys does a disservice to caring school parents” and written by Melissa Radovich, who was identified at the end as merely “a mother who lives in the Sarasota County Schools district and … an executive at an area manufacturing education company.”
